1970 Cadillac DeVille vs. 1999 Mahindra CL

To start off, 1999 Mahindra CL is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Cadillac DeVille.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Cadillac DeVille would be higher. At 7,735 cc (8 cylinders), 1970 Cadillac DeVille is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1970 Cadillac DeVille (288 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 226 more horse power than 1999 Mahindra CL. (62 HP @ 3200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1970 Cadillac DeVille should accelerate faster than 1999 Mahindra CL.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 Cadillac DeVille weights approximately 770 kg more than 1999 Mahindra CL.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

1970 Cadillac DeVille 1999 Mahindra CL
Make Cadillac Mahindra
Model DeVille CL
Year Released 1970 1999
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 7735 cc 2523 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 288 HP 62 HP
Engine RPM 4600 RPM 3200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Rear Rear
Vehicle Weight 2000 kg 1230 kg
Vehicle Length 5700 mm 3360 mm
Vehicle Width 2030 mm 1460 mm
Wheelbase Size 3300 mm 2040 mm
